MEMO — Regional Sales Review

To the incoming director: numbers first. Northfell region up 9%, Carberry flat, Dunmaw down 14% for the second straight quarter. Root cause is the stalled Brightline reseller channel, not headcount. Fessler's team has a recovery plan; it needs your sign-off within two weeks. Pipeline data is in the shared tracker. One item cannot wait for your first staff meeting. It is set out directly below.

internal memo for hahaf-kahof: Only 39 of the 428 pilot accounts renewed Sorion, so a churn review is set for April 12. Praokix Freight is in early talks to buy Queniusox Group for about $145.8 million.

# Thumbnail Queue — Frostbay Pipeline (.env header)
# Reviewed for the quarterly security audit.
# This file configures the Frostbay thumbnail generation queue: worker
# concurrency, the retry backoff ceiling, and the dead-letter topic name.
# All values below are non-sensitive except one: the queue broker
# credential, which grants publish and consume rights on the thumbnail
# topics and must never be committed to source control or echoed in
# logs. That broker credential is set on the very next line.

sealed setting: ARCHIVE_KEY3=8d0

Minutes — Management Meeting, Branch Operations

Attendees: Ops heads, regional leads.

Decision confirmed: Pellbrook Couriers replaces Ardwyn Haulage from next quarter across all branches. Branch managers should audit outstanding Ardwyn consignments by the 20th and flag anything in transit. Pellbrook onboarding packs go out this week; training is a half-day per site. Costs are broadly neutral in year one. Managers should also be aware of the following, which is not for wider circulation.

management briefing: The pricing group signed off on a budget of $378.8 million for Project Kasael.